On the journey from average to amazing, you’ll soon realize that there are several skills you need to learn or improve.  But as a high performer I’m willing to bet that you’re already busy and short on time. In that case, we need to make the learning process as efficient as possible.  One way to accomplish this is by deciding exactly how competent you need to be at each skill.  Some things require you to be an expert, while in others you only need enough to communicate with the external pros you hire.
 
Show notes and illustrations: focusthefire.com/skillsandlevels
  1. Skills to master
  2. Skills to be proficient
  3. Skills to understand
  4. Skills to appreciate and delegate

The Focus the Fire podcast dedicated to helping people like you design and create more meaningful careers. 40+ hours each week is way too much time to burn being miserable or unintentional. 
 
On this episode we look at a powerful way to reframe your professional life and move from being an employee, to a super hero in your own movie series. Who doesn’t love a good story right?
 
Let’s get started with some of your own epic tales.  
 
Here are 10 Questions to guide your story:
 
  1. What are the abilities you want to showcase in this narrative? “Tell us about a time when you had to…” 
  2. Besides you, who are the other main characters needed to make this a great story?
  3. What is the major problem or conflict that you will solve?
  4. Can you describe it vividly in numbers, costs, or how long (time) the problem has been around?
  5. Why do you feel a strong desire to address this issue?
  6. Are there particular skills you have now or will develop to handle this issue like a boss?
  7. In 2-3 brief sentences, what is your plan of action? How will you save the day (or hour)?
  8. What challenges do you expect along the path to success?
  9. What is the outcome or resolution you would like to produce?
  10. How will this impact people directly involved or your community?

What’s the point of all of this really? Chasing jobs, promotions, connecting with influential people, generating income.
 
The truth is that you will probably never feel like you have enough money.  It’s like sugar and other drugs - addictive.  You set financial goals. Maybe its buying a house, taking a fancy vacation, seeing your bank account hit a certain number, paying off debt, saving money.  No matter how high the goal, reaching it will only build your confidence and increase your appetite. So if we begin with money as the end goal, there will be no end, just a life filled with cycles of dissatisfaction. 
 
In this episode I share my no-nonsense approach to budgeting and the main software/app I use for managing personal finances. 
 
Money is a means, don’t let it be your end.

Focus The Fire Episode 036 - How to scale you
 
  • Systems over transactions
  • Get what's inside your head on paper. 
  • Document the process, especially for things you seem to do intuitively. 
  • Experiment with delegating certain tasks, or just ask someone to follow your instructions. 
    • Where to they ask questions? 
    • What went well or wrong?
    • How can it be more clear?
    • Can it be more efficient? 
  • There's only 1 you, but millions of dollars to make. 
  • Put your time toward its highest use. 
    • Is this task part of my core skills?
    • Is there someone else who can do this better or faster, while I do something more profitable? 
  • Review the process for improvements and adjust quickly
  • Shorten the feedback loop
    • Create, test, review, adjust. Repeat. 
    • Don't let fear lure you into procrastination
  • Tools to assist
    • Microsoft word / Apple Pages
    • Evernote
    • Trello

035 - Finding your G spot
 
 
You might be good at several things, but there are 1 or 2 areas where your natural ability begins to shine brighter than usual. This doesn’t mean that you’ll automatically be amazing at this skill but you feel a level of comfort that makes you want to linger there and perfect that craft. As you get closer to that place you get excited about explore how deep the experience can go. This is your area of genius, your “G-spot” and magic lives here!
 
Finding your G-spot
  • What skill or area would you be willing to invested at least 5% of your income to develop and train?
  • If you could invest the time needed to be come an expert in one thing, what would it be?
  • What are the top three things that make you miserable at work? (Talking to people, sitting behind a desk, crunching numbers, et cetera)
 
Surviving the search
  • Identify a compelling reason for finding your G-spot. What specific needs will this satisfy in your life and the people or causes you care about?
  • Try to turn your current assignment into paid research & development for your G-spot
  • Schedule a specific time or amount of time you will spend each day perfecting your craft
